Red Maple.  Acer Rubrum.

Tiger Maple, also known as Curly Maple, is a figured wood. The grain of the wood grows in a distinctive stripe or flame pattern. Tiger Maple is one of the world’s most sought-after woods. Scientists still do not understand what creates the elegant figure, or distinctive pattern, in the grain of some Maples. 

Available in the Premium grade in widths of 3 to 8 inches, and in the Natural grade in widths of 3 to 10 inches.

Red Maple’s properties are similar to that of Sugar Maple.  The sapwood is grayish white and the heartwood is brown. It makes a very durable floor. 

A hallmark of fine New England furniture making from the Colonial period to the present, Curly Maple remains a favorite of woodworkers and wood enthusiasts for its beauty, rarity, and mystery.
